About New Berlin

New Berlin is a Guadalupe County town founded in 1868 by German immigrants east of Cibolo Creek. The name points straight back to Berlin, Germany, and Carl August Edward ‘Ed’ Tewes is remembered as the town’s founding father. Tewes built the first store, and a post office operated here from 1878 to 1906. By the 1880s, New Berlin had mills, cotton gins, and a shipping trade in cotton, corn, and oats. It is a small German-Texas place whose first chapter still reads like a family ledger and a post-office-era storefront.
